110 if (!Details.LineStarts.empty()) {
111 // Now we convert the line number information from the address/DebugLoc
112 // format in Details to the address/filename/lineno format that OProfile
113 // expects. Note that OProfile 0.9.4 has a bug that causes it to ignore
114 // line numbers for addresses above 4G.
115 FilenameCache Filenames;
116 std::vector<debug_line_info> LineInfo;
117 LineInfo.reserve(1 + Details.LineStarts.size());
119 DebugLoc FirstLoc = Details.LineStarts[0].Loc;
120 assert(!FirstLoc.isUnknown()
121 && "LineStarts should not contain unknown DebugLocs");
122 MDNode *FirstLocScope = FirstLoc.getScope(F.getContext());
123 DISubprogram FunctionDI = getDISubprogram(FirstLocScope);
124 if (FunctionDI.Verify()) {
125 // If we have debug info for the function itself, use that as the line
126 // number of the first several instructions. Otherwise, after filling
127 // LineInfo, we'll adjust the address of the first line number to point at
128 // the start of the function.
129 debug_line_info line_info;
130 line_info.vma = reinterpret_cast<uintptr_t>(FnStart);
131 line_info.lineno = FunctionDI.getLineNumber();
132 line_info.filename = Filenames.getFilename(FirstLocScope);
133 LineInfo.push_back(line_info);
136 for (std::vector<EmittedFunctionDetails::LineStart>::const_iterator
137 I = Details.LineStarts.begin(), E = Details.LineStarts.end();
139 LineInfo.push_back(LineStartToOProfileFormat(
140 *Details.MF, Filenames, I->Address, I->Loc));
143 // In case the function didn't have line info of its own, adjust the first
144 // line info's address to include the start of the function.
145 LineInfo[0].vma = reinterpret_cast<uintptr_t>(FnStart);
